Basin with reliefs depicting a procession (Thiasos) with Tritons and Nereids with weapons forged by Hephaestus for Achilles. Pentelic marble. Found in the Hospital of the Holy Spirit (Rome). 120 BC. National Roman Museum. Palazzo Massimo. Rome. Italy. Mary Evans Picture Library makes available wonderful images created for people to enjoy over the centuries. © Thaliastock / Mary Evans
